Voting alignment

Wera Hobhouse and Grahame Morris voted the same way 80% of the time, based on 1,301 shared comparable votes.

1,044 same votes 257 different votes 1,301 shared votes

Alignment only includes divisions where both MPs recorded an Aye or No vote. Tellers, absences, abstentions, and missing votes are excluded.
